ISRchain: Achieving efficient interdomain secure routing with blockchain
Extensive efforts have been made for securing interdomain routing during the last two decades, but the highly centralized nature and complex management of existing security solutions impede their deployment progress. This paper presents ISRchain, a blockchain-based interdomain secure routing framewo...
Gespeichert in:
Veröffentlicht in: | Computers & electrical engineering 2020-05, Vol.83, p.106584-14, Article 106584 |
---|---|
Hauptverfasser: | , , , , |
Format: | Artikel |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| Extensive efforts have been made for securing interdomain routing during the last two decades, but the highly centralized nature and complex management of existing security solutions impede their deployment progress. This paper presents ISRchain, a blockchain-based interdomain secure routing framework. We utilize blockchain as a distributed, tamper-proof, and traceable ledger to store the distributions of Internet number resources consistently and design a smart contract-based mechanism for route origin verification, AS adjacency attestation, and route policy compliance check. ISRchain decouples the data required for route validation from routing protocols to work independently without requiring any changes in the current interdomain routing system. We conduct extensive experiments to evaluate ISRchain’s performance by simulating Internet resource allocation in the real world and show its effectiveness and efficiency by performing two case studies with BHARTI Airtel prefix hijack in 2015 and Google route leak in 2017. Experimental results demonstrate the feasibility of ISRchain for securing interdomain routing. |
---|---|
ISSN: | 0045-7906 1879-0755 |
DOI: | 10.1016/j.compeleceng.2020.106584 |